Bridget's feedback:
"This essay shows that you have a great eye for detail and narrative. Using the house-by-house "tour" to organize the essay draws the reader into the world, creating a sense of movement and arrival into the thoughts and emotions of the conclusion. The timing of whether the move has been undertaken already or not is a little confusing, with the opening suggesting it already happened and the ending describing it as happening in the future. A targeted revision will help clear this up, probably by tweaking the verb tense or clarifying the use of a frame for the narrative. A similar task will be a thorough proofread to catch errors and typos -- keep an eye out for correct punctuation."
